The upcoming all-electric Volvo XC40 is getting a new Android-powered infotainment system that will offer over-the-air updates and integrates Google Maps, Google Assistant and Google Play Store.
Volvo ’s new in-house Range Assistant application will be embedded within the new Android Automotive infotainment screen present on all XC40 EV models.
